top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

TP钱包合约功能详解及安全性分析

  • 2025-01-22 16:18:09

      随着区块链技术的迅猛发展,智能合约的使用日益普及,TP钱包作为一款知名的数字资产管理工具,其合约功能备受用户关注。本文将详细探讨TP钱包是否能够进行合约操作,并对其安全性进行深入分析。同时,我们还将关注用户在使用TP钱包进行合约操作时可能遇到的问题。

      TP钱包的基本功能介绍

      TP钱包,作为一种多功能的数字钱包,支持多种区块链资产的管理,包括但不限于以太坊、EOS、波场等。它不仅具备存储、转账等基本功能,还支持DApp的使用,用户可以通过TP钱包直接访问各种去中心化应用,从而进行资产的增值和交易。

      除了资产管理外,TP钱包还有一个重要的功能就是智能合约的执行。智能合约是一段自动执行、不可篡改的代码,可以帮助用户实现自动化的操作。因此,TP钱包的合约功能使得用户可以更方便地进行数字资产的管理与交易。

      TP钱包支持的合约类型

      TP钱包支持多种类型的智能合约,特别是在以太坊等区块链平台上。用户可以通过TP钱包与众多DApp进行互动,其中很多DApp在其背后使用了智能合约。这些合约可以实现各种功能,包括去中心化金融(DeFi)应用、游戏、NFT市场等。

      用户在TP钱包上可以创建自己的智能合约,进行资产的托管、交易和转移。通过TP钱包,用户不仅可以使用已有的合约,还可以根据自身需求,自行书写功能更为复杂的合约,为自身资产管理提供了高度的灵活性。

      TP钱包合约的安全性分析

      智能合约的安全性是用户在进行合约操作时最为关心的问题之一。TP钱包作为用户与智能合约交互的桥梁,其安全性直接影响到用户的资产安全。TP钱包在多年的发展过程中,已经建立了一套较为完善的安全机制。

      首先,TP钱包采用了多重签名技术,用户在进行合约操作时需要验证多次身份,有效降低了被盗风险。其次,TP钱包内置的合约审核系统,会对用户所使用的合约代码进行初步的安全检测,及时识别出潜在的安全隐患。

      此外,TP钱包团队会定期进行安全审计,并及时发布安全更新,以应对新的安全威胁。用户在下载和更新钱包时应选择官方渠道,以确保使用的版本是最新且安全的。

      使用TP钱包合约的优势

      TP钱包的合约功能不仅为用户提供了便利,还有以下几方面的优势:

      • 高效性:用户可以快速创建和部署智能合约,操作过程简便,节省了时间成本。
      • 兼容性强:TP钱包可与多种区块链平台兼容,用户可以跨链操作,享受更广泛的服务。
      • 去中心化:智能合约在区块链上执行,去除了中介的干扰,提高了交易的透明度和安全性。

      TP钱包合约的潜在风险

      虽然TP钱包在合约的安全性上做了很多保障,但用户在使用中仍应意识到一些潜在风险:

      • 代码漏洞:如果用户自定义的合约代码存在漏洞,可能导致资产损失。
      • 社会工程学攻击:黑客可能通过各种手段获取用户私钥,进行资产盗窃。
      • 合约安全性依赖合约作者:与知名平台的合约相比,一些不知名合约可能存在未知风险。

      因此,用户在选择和使用合约时,应仔细评估合约的安全性,推荐选择知名度较高且经过审计的合约。

      用户在使用TP钱包合约时常见问题

      在用户使用TP钱包的合约功能时,可能会遇到一些问题。以下是五个常见问题及其详细解答。

      如何在TP钱包中创建智能合约?

      创建智能合约的过程涉及多个步骤,以下是具体步骤:

      1. 选择模板:用户可以通过TP钱包选择现成的智能合约模板,例如用于交易的ERC20合约、NFT合约等。
      2. 自定义参数:根据自身需求修改合约参数,例如代币名称、总供应量、交易费用等。
      3. 编写合约代码:如果现有模板无法满足您的需求,可以自己编写智能合约代码。使用如Solidity等编程语言。
      4. 审核合约:在部署合约前,强烈建议使用TP钱包内置的代码审核工具,分析合约中潜在的安全问题。
      5. 部署合约:合约审核完成后,用户可以选择部署合约,此时需要支付一定的网络费用,确保合约顺利上线。

      在整个过程中,用户需保持警惕,确保合约代码无误。合约一旦部署,无法更改,因此谨慎为上。

      使用TP钱包合约的转账安全性如何保障?

      TP钱包在合约转账过程中采取了多项安全保障措施,确保用户的资金安全:

      • 多重签名技术:TP钱包支持多重签名转账机制,用户需完成多次身份验证,确保交易安全。
      • 交易额度限制:用户可以自行设置每次交易的额度,防止大额资金在一次操作中被转走。
      • 实时监控:TP钱包会实时监控用户账户的异常操作,一旦发现异常行为,将会立刻警示用户。

      此外,用户应定期更换TP钱包的密码,并启用双因素认证,以进一步提高安全性。

      TP钱包合约操作失败的原因有哪些?

      在使用TP钱包进行合约操作时,用户可能会遇到合约操作失败的情况。失败的原因可能有多种,以下是一些常见原因:

      • gas费用不足:合约执行需要消耗一定的gas,如果用户设置的gas限制过低,合约将无法完成执行。
      • 合约逻辑错误:如果合约代码逻辑有误,可能导致执行失败。因此,开发者在编写合约时须注意代码的正确性。
      • 网络堵塞:如果区块链网络出现拥堵,交易可能会被延迟处理,导致合约操作失败。

      为了解决这些问题,用户在操作合约前需仔细检查合约设定,并根据当前网络情况调整gas费用。

      什么情况下需要对TP钱包合约进行审计?

      合约审计是确保合约安全性的重要手段。以下是一些常见的情况,用户可能需要对TP钱包合约进行审计:

      • 复杂合约:如果合约功能较为复杂,涉及多种操作,建议进行第三方审计,确保合约逻辑的正确性。
      • 大额资金:在处理拥有大额资金的合约时,应尽可能提高安全性,选择专业机构进行审计。
      • 更改合约:如果对已部署的合约进行了修改,强烈建议重新审计,以发现潜在的安全风险。

      进行合约审计时,用户应选择有口碑且经验丰富的审计公司,以确保审计结果的可靠性。

      如何提高使用TP钱包合约的安全性?

      用户在使用TP钱包合约时,可采取以下措施提高安全性:

      • 定期更换密码:用户应定期更换TP钱包的密码,并选择强密码,以减少被破解的风险。
      • 启用二次认证:务必启用二次认证功能,这能有效防止未经授权的操作。
      • 审查合约:在使用合约前,仔细审查合约代码的安全性,并选择经过审计的合约。
      • 保持软件更新:及时更新TP钱包,安装后续版本以享受更好的安全保障。

      遵循以上建议,能进一步增强用户在TP钱包合约操作中的安全性,减少因操作而导致的风险。

      综上所述,TP钱包不仅支持合约功能,其安全性也在不断受到增强。通过本文对TP钱包合约的详细介绍,希望能够帮助用户更好地利用这一工具进行数字资产的管理。同时,使用合约时需谨慎,并对潜在风险保持警惕。

      • Tags
      • TP钱包,合约,安全性